Ni No Kuni II: Revenant Kingdom Has Gone Gold

By Keith MitchellFebruary 23, 2018
Ni No Kuni II on Xbox One

You ready for some Ni no Kuni II loving? Well, if you aren’t, you better be, as the game has finally gone gold. After two delays, the upcoming JRPG from Bandai Namco and Level 5 is releasing on March 23, 2018.

The follow-up to an amazing JRPG, Ni no Kuni: Wrath of the White Witch. This second venture takes place hundreds of years after the original title. You’ll play as Evan Pettiwhisker Tildrum, a displaced king who has set out to reclaim his kingdom. Along the way, he’ll join up with multiple allies, fight hordes of enemies and hopefully reclaim that his throne.

To celebrate the eventual release, a new featurette was released. As part of their ongoing series, Ni Ni no Kuni II – Behind the Scenes, this latest feature looks at the combat system, as well as building up your kingdom. We also get to see some new gameplay that wasn’t shown off before. Definitely, give it a watch if you’re looking forward to this game.

I have to say, this title caught me by surprise. I had a chance to check it out during E3 2017 and while the game wasn’t even on my radar, I have to say that I can’t wait to get some quality time with it now. 

Ni No Kuni II: Revenant Kingdom releases on March 23, 2018, for the PlayStation 4 and PC (Steam).
